对于开发者来说,如何为开源项目选择一个合适的开源许可证,可能比写一万行代码更难:
那么多种类和版本的许可证令人眼花缭乱,各种晦涩难懂的条款更是让人头大——如何理解其中的法律知识、理清相应的权利、义务?
但是,开源许可证不仅对于项目作者来说非常重要,对开源项目的使用者也同等重要。
为此,Gitee 上线了开源许可证引导功能,我们会对没有许可证的公开仓库进行提示,如下图所示:
你可以通过开源许可证的向导,回答几个相关问题,由系统根据评分给出最适合的许可证供你选择,如下图所示:
另外,当用户浏览一个没有开源许可证的 Gitee 仓库时,也会看到如下警告提示:
对于一个没有开源许可证的仓库来说,未经作者的许可,代码仅能用于学习,不能用于其他任何用途!
———————–
对于开源来说,公开代码只是第一步。
我们希望通过该功能,让更多开发者熟悉开源许可证,保护自身权益,规范开源项目的开发和使用。
接下来我们还会不断优化该特性,欢迎大家给 Gitee 提建议 :)
来源:CSDN
作者:ZicoChan
链接:https://blog.csdn.net/ZicoChan/article/details/103703634